The gasket creates a positive seal between the oil pipe fitting and the turbocharger housing, preventing hot, pressurized engine oil from escaping at this critical connection point and spraying onto the glowing exhaust manifold or turbine housing.
The 1001317646 gasket is a critical fire-safety component. An oil leak at the turbocharger can spray a fine mist of hot oil onto surfaces that exceed the oil’s auto-ignition temperature, causing a sudden and extremely dangerous engine fire.
The gasket is designed to deform slightly when the fitting is torqued, conforming perfectly to both mating surfaces. This one-time crush feature means the gasket must always be replaced whenever the oil connection is disassembled for any service.
The turbocharger oil pipe gasket 1001317646 is installed at the connection between the oil pipe banjo fitting and the turbocharger bearing housing, or at the flange connection where the oil drain tube attaches to the engine block on the Shacman X5000 engine. Before installation, both sealing surfaces must be absolutely clean and free of any old gasket material, oil residue, or debris. For banjo-type connections, one gasket is placed on each side of the banjo fitting, so the fitting is sandwiched between two new gaskets. The banjo bolt is threaded through the assembly and into the housing by hand to avoid cross-threading. The bolt is then torqued to the exact factory specification using a calibrated torque wrench. The specified torque is critical; under-torquing will result in an oil leak, while over-torquing can crack the banjo fitting or strip the threads in the turbocharger housing. After the engine is started and brought to operating temperature, the connection must be visually inspected for any signs of oil seepage before the vehicle is returned to service.

The turbocharger oil pipe connections should be visually inspected during every routine engine service for any signs of oil seepage, wetness, or coked oil deposits around the banjo bolt heads or flange connections. Any indication of an oil leak must be investigated immediately. An oil leak at the turbocharger is a serious safety concern due to the fire risk, and it can also progressively reduce engine oil level, potentially leading to engine damage from oil starvation.
The turbocharger oil pipe gasket is a single-use component that must be replaced with a new 1001317646 part whenever the oil connection is loosened or disassembled for any reason, including turbocharger replacement, oil pipe replacement, or any other service that disturbs the fitting. Never reuse an oil pipe gasket; the used gasket has already been crushed and will not provide a reliable seal when reinstalled. The turbocharger oil pipe gasket 1001317646 functions on the principle of controlled compression. As the banjo bolt or fitting fastener is torqued to specification, the gasket material deforms slightly, flowing into the microscopic surface imperfections of both the fitting and the turbocharger housing. This creates a continuous, impermeable barrier that prevents oil molecules from finding a path through the joint. The gasket material is selected to be softer than the mating components, so it conforms to them without causing any deformation or damage to the more expensive turbocharger housing or oil pipe fitting.
When installing a banjo-type oil connection, it is essential to place one gasket on each side of the banjo fitting. The fitting must be centered on the bolt so that both gaskets receive uniform compression. If a gasket is omitted on one side or if two gaskets are accidentally stacked on one side, the joint will leak. After torquing the banjo bolt, a common practice is to gently tap the bolt head with a soft-faced hammer to help the gaskets settle, then recheck the torque. This technique can help achieve a more reliable seal on critical oil connections.
